WebThe prefix poly- means many, so a polyatomic ion is an ion that contains more than one atom. This differentiates polyatomic ions from monatomic ions, which contain only one atom. Examples of monatomic ions include \text {Na}^+ Na+, \text {Fe}^ {3+} Fe3+, \text {Cl}^- Cl−, and many, many others. This article assumes you have a knowledge of ...
WebThe chemical formula shows that each formula unit of CaCl2 contains one Ca2+ and two Cl− ions. Therefore, there will be twice as many Cl− ions in solution as Ca2+ ions. So we need three … chip berryWebPhosphate can be given in doses up to about 1 g orally 3 times a day in tablets containing sodium phosphate or potassium phosphate. Oral sodium phosphate or potassium phosphate may be poorly tolerated because of diarrhea.
